Explore the sweeping panorama of spiritual and historical evolution in Kenneth Morris's "The Crest-Wave of Evolution." Originally delivered as lectures at the Raja-Yoga College in Point Loma during the college year 1918-19, this profound work delves into the currents of theosophy, spirituality, and history that shape human understanding. Morris guides readers through a comprehensive exploration of the forces driving evolution, drawing connections between ancient wisdom and the unfolding narrative of civilization. This meticulously prepared print edition offers insights into the timeless principles of spiritual growth and the interconnectedness of all things. Discover the enduring relevance of these lectures, which illuminate the path toward a deeper understanding of ourselves and our place in the cosmos. Perfect for those interested in theosophy, yoga, and the history of spiritual thought.
